Výstup

Zavření okna terminálu nezabije skript spuštěný pomocí sudo

Zavření okna terminálu nezabije skript spuštěný pomocí sudo
  1. Jak mohu zavřít terminál, aniž bych proces zabil?
  2. Jak ukončím terminál bash skript?
  3. Jak mohu zabránit zavření aplikací po zavření terminálu?
  4. Jak zastavíte spuštění shell skriptu?
  5. Jak mohu zavřít příkaz terminálu?
  6. Jak mohu odpojit proces v Terminálu?
  7. Jak ukončíte chybu bash skriptu?
  8. Jak mohu ukončit režim bash v systému Unix?
  9. Jaký je rozsah výstupních kódů pro neúspěšné provedení příkazu?
  10. Jak odhlásím SSH v terminálu?
  11. Jak mohu po odhlášení zabránit spuštění systému Linux?
  12. Jak se znovu připojím k odpojené relaci ssh?

Jak mohu zavřít terminál, aniž bych proces zabil?

Nejjednodušší řešení

  1. Ctrl + Z proces pozastavíte.
  2. bg pro obnovení procesu na pozadí.
  3. disown -ah k odstranění všech úloh z shellu a jejich ignorování SIGHUP.
  4. výjezd k uzavření terminálu.

Jak ukončím terminál bash skript?

Můžeš použít ./ váš skript; výstup .

Chcete-li to provést, spusťte příkaz a příkaz exit, oddělené; takže mohou být uvedeny na jednom řádku. Syntaxe je příkaz; výstup, např.G., ./ váš skript; výstup .

Jak mohu zabránit zavření aplikací po zavření terminálu?

Pokud používáte tmux nebo screen a spustíte aplikaci your_application zevnitř, můžete se znovu připojit k "výstupu" po zavření terminálu a otevření jiného. Aplikaci můžete také spustit normálně, pak ji stisknutím Ctrl + Z pozastavíte a spustíte bg na pozadí a poté terminál čistě ukončíte.

Jak zastavíte spuštění shell skriptu?

Chcete-li zastavit běžící proces, můžete stisknout Ctrl + C, čímž se vygeneruje signál SIGINT, který zastaví aktuální proces běžící v shellu.

Jak mohu zavřít příkaz terminálu?

Chcete-li zavřít okno terminálu, můžete použít příkaz exit . Případně můžete použít klávesovou zkratku ctrl + shift + w k zavření karty terminálu a ctrl + shift + q k zavření celého terminálu včetně všech karet.

Jak mohu odpojit proces v Terminálu?

Existuje několik způsobů, jak toho dosáhnout. Nejjednodušší a nejběžnější je pravděpodobně pouze odeslat na pozadí a vzdát se procesu. Pomocí Ctrl + Z pozastavte program, pak bg spusťte proces na pozadí a disown jej odpojte od aktuální relace terminálu.

Jak ukončíte chybu bash skriptu?

-e Okamžitě ukončete, pokud je příkaz ukončen se nenulovým stavem. Pokud některý z vašich příkazů selže, skript se ukončí. Skript můžete ukončit kdekoli pomocí klíčového slova exit . Můžete také zadat kód ukončení, abyste ostatním programům naznačili, že nebo jak selhal váš skript, např.G. výstup 1 nebo výstup 2 atd.

Jak mohu ukončit režim bash v systému Unix?

Chcete-li opustit bash, zadejte exit a stiskněte klávesu ENTER . Pokud je vaše shell výzva > možná jste zadali 'nebo ", abyste určili řetězec jako součást příkazu prostředí, ale nezadali jste jiný' nebo" pro zavření řetězce. Chcete-li přerušit aktuální příkaz, stiskněte CTRL-C .

Jaký je rozsah výstupních kódů pro neúspěšné provedení příkazu?

Po ukončení skriptu se zobrazí $? z příkazového řádku udává stav ukončení skriptu, tj. poslední příkaz provedený ve skriptu, což je podle konvence 0 při úspěchu nebo celé číslo v rozsahu 1 - 255 při chybě.

Jak odhlásím SSH v terminálu?

1 Odpověď. CTRL + d způsobí odhlášení .

Jak mohu po odhlášení zabránit spuštění systému Linux?

Pokud chcete, aby proces pokračoval v provozu i po odhlášení ze systému Linux, máte několik možností. Jedním z nich je použití příkazu disown. Řekne vašemu prostředí, aby se při odhlášení zdrželo odeslání signálu HUP (zablokování) procesu. Proces tedy běží dál.

Jak se znovu připojím k odpojené relaci ssh?

Základy jsou:

  1. Spusťte relaci obrazovky (na vzdáleném hostiteli): $ obrazovka.
  2. Odpojte se od relace obrazovky: CTRL-A, d.
  3. Po opětovném přihlášení se znovu připojte k relaci obrazovky: $ screen -d -r.
  4. Otevřete další „okno“ další obrazovky: CTRL-A, c.
  5. Procházejte otevřenými okny obrazovky: CTRL-A, mezera.

Existuje známý problém s občasným restartováním MacBooků a Bluetooth?
Proč se Bluetooth na Macu stále odpojuje? Proč se Bluetooth stále odpojuje? Jak víte, že váš Macbook umírá? Jak mohu opravit problém s macOS Catalina ...
MacBook Pro 15 2017 Bluetooth se znovu připojí, když je připojena myš
Proč se moje Bluetooth na MacBooku Pro stále odpojuje? Proč se můj Mac Bluetooth stále odpojuje? Jak mohu opravit zpoždění myši Bluetooth na mém počít...
Proč se různé náhlavní soupravy Bluetooth na iPhonu párují různými způsoby?
Můžete k iPhone připojit více sluchátek Bluetooth? Můžete spárovat 2 sluchátka Bluetooth najednou? Mohou náhlavní soupravy Bluetooth mezi sebou mluvit...